To ship with PayPal, follow these simple steps:
1. Log in to your PayPal account: If you don’t already have a PayPal account, you’ll need to create one before you can access PayPal’s shipping services.
2. Click on “Tools” and then “All Tools” in the top navigation bar.
3. Under “Manage your business,” select “PayPal Shipping.”
4. Enter the recipient’s shipping address: Once you’ve accessed PayPal Shipping, you can enter the recipient’s shipping address to get rates and select a shipping service.
5. Choose a shipping service: PayPal offers several shipping options, including USPS, UPS, and FedEx. You can compare rates and delivery times to choose the best option for your needs.
6. Print your shipping label: Once you’ve selected a shipping service, you can print your shipping label directly from your PayPal account. Simply attach the label to your package and drop it off at the nearest shipping location.
7. Track your shipment: After you’ve sent your package, you can track its progress through your PayPal account to ensure it reaches its destination safely and on time.

FAQs:
1. Can I ship internationally with PayPal?
Yes, PayPal offers international shipping options through carriers like USPS, UPS, and FedEx. You can easily ship packages to customers around the world using PayPal’s international shipping services.
2. How do I calculate shipping costs with PayPal?
You can calculate shipping costs by entering the recipient’s address and package dimensions into PayPal’s shipping tool. PayPal will provide you with a list of available shipping services and their corresponding rates for you to choose from.
3. Can I schedule a pickup for my packages with PayPal?
Yes, you can schedule a pickup for your packages with select carriers through PayPal. Simply choose the pickup option when creating your shipping label, and the carrier will pick up your package from your location.
4. Are there any discounts available for shipping with PayPal?
PayPal offers discounted shipping rates for USPS, UPS, and FedEx services. By using PayPal’s shipping services, you can save money on your shipping costs and pass those savings on to your customers.
5. How can I reprint a shipping label with PayPal?
If you need to reprint a shipping label, you can do so by accessing your PayPal account, locating the transaction for the label, and selecting the option to reprint the label. You can then print the label again and attach it to your package.
6. Does PayPal provide insurance for shipped packages?
Some shipping services offered through PayPal include insurance coverage for lost or damaged packages. You can select an insured shipping service to protect your packages during transit.
7. Can I ship oversized or heavy packages with PayPal?
Yes, PayPal offers shipping services for oversized or heavy packages through carriers like UPS and FedEx. You can enter the dimensions and weight of your package to get rates for shipping large items.
8. How do I handle returns for shipped items with PayPal?
If a customer needs to return an item, you can create a return shipping label through PayPal’s shipping tool. Simply enter the return address and package details to generate a label for the customer to use.
9. Can I ship perishable items with PayPal?
Yes, you can ship perishable items with PayPal, but you’ll need to select a shipping service that can accommodate perishable goods and provide proper packaging to ensure the items arrive safely.
10. Are there restrictions on what I can ship with PayPal?
PayPal has guidelines and restrictions on what can be shipped, including prohibited items like hazardous materials, illegal goods, and certain animal products. Be sure to review PayPal’s shipping policies before sending your packages.
